Music News: Man Pleads Guilty To Stealing Beyoncé Music

After stealing unreleased Beyoncé music and set lists from her choreographer’s car during last summer, a man has pleaded guilty to all charges.



It was in July of 2025 that officials from the Atlanta Police Department (APD) reported two suitcases belonging to Christopher Grant and backup dancer Diandre Blue (containing two laptops and hard drives of unreleased music, watermarked music, footage plans, and draft set lists) had been stolen from a rented Jeep Wagoneer parked at Krog Street Market in Atlanta, Georgia.



After being arrested in August and charged with criminal trespass and entering a vehicle with intent to commit theft, on Tuesday (5.12) Kelvin Evans pleaded guilty in court.



According to ABC News, the defendant was sentenced to five years, with two years to be served in custody and the remaining time on probation.



As part of a plea deal, a second charge was merged into the first count, and the judge also ordered Evans to avoid the area where the robbery occurred, to “have no contact with the victim, and commit no further violations of the law”.
